The first step to playing poker online is finding a trusted site. A reputable site will have passed numerous tests and be licensed by a respected gambling authority. Additionally, it will have a secure connection that protects your personal information. If you’re unsure about which site to choose, read reviews and ratings from other players to get an idea of the quality of service and security measures.

Once you’ve found a trusted poker site, it’s time to sign up and start playing for real money. Before you start wagering any money, make sure to check out the site’s terms of service and deposit options. Most sites offer a variety of ways to deposit and withdraw funds, including credit cards, debit cards, pre-paid cards, eWallets and bank transfers. Once you’ve settled on a method, stick to it and set limits for your sessions so you don’t overspend.

Learning the poker rules and terminology can be a bit overwhelming but once you’ve got the basics down online things get a lot easier. A few of the more important terms to know include “call” – betting the minimum amount needed to continue your inclusion in the hand, “fold” – discarding your cards face down and declaring you’re out of the round, and “tell” – a physical action or change in demeanour that suggests your card strength is stronger (or weaker) than it actually is.

Legal Online Poker in the USA

After a flurry of excitement in 2013 when three states chose to regulate online poker, progress towards a nationwide market has been slow. This is largely due to differing views on how the industry should be regulated and the role that horse racing interests should have in it.
